About The Position

The incumbent coordinates comprehensive services for oncology patients receiving care through the Infusion Suite and Hematology/Oncology Clinic. Responsibilities include patient scheduling, referral processing, insurance verification, prior authorizations, financial counseling, program enrollment, and ensuring effective communication among patients, providers, payers, and referring physicians.

Responsibilities

  • Coordinate and schedule appointments for oncology patients, including infusion treatments, clinic visits, radiation oncology services, and related procedures.
  • Answer and triage calls for the Infusion Suite and Hematology/Oncology Clinic.
  • Process patient orders in the EPIC electronic health record system.
  • Obtain and secure prior authorizations for same-day and next-day procedures and services.
  • Verify insurance coverage, benefits, and eligibility; obtain pre-certifications and authorizations as required.
  • Review patient accounts to ensure appropriate financial documentation, authorization approvals, and account notes are completed and maintained.
  • Complete Medicare Secondary Payer (MSP) documentation and re-verify Medicaid and financial information as required.
  • Receive and process referrals from Hematology/Oncology providers, clinical trial staff, and other specialty services.
  • Verify all required referral documentation, including physician orders, consents, and supporting clinical information.
  • Perform medical necessity and financial clearance reviews for infusion services.
  • Coordinate with pharmacy, social work, home health agencies, and other support services to facilitate patient care.
  • Assist patients with enrollment in manufacturer-sponsored drug assistance programs and other financial assistance resources.
  • Assemble and maintain new patient records and work collaboratively with providers and nursing staff to prevent treatment delays.
  • Provide financial counseling, communicate cost estimates, collect prepayments, establish payment plans, and assist uninsured patients with sponsorship and assistance programs.
  • Maintain accurate demographic and financial information within the health system.
  • Manage Infusion Center scheduling to optimize resource utilization, prioritize patient needs, and support efficient operations.
  • Serve as a key liaison among physicians, patients, nurses, payers, and ancillary departments to ensure seamless coordination of care.
